Quản trị mạng – Trong bài này sẽ giới thiệu cho những bạn một tiện ích nhỏ, miễn phí nhưng lại khá hữu dụng. Đây chính là một trong những nhữngh tốt nhất mà mang thể làm cho những máy tính của bạn làm việc chính xác theo những gì bạn muốn.
AutoHotkey (viết tắt là AHK) là một macro recorder, tên của nó đã nói nên tất cả, chương trình này mang thể lưu lại một chuỗi trình tự bàn phím, chuột và sau đó cho phép bạn thực hiện lại chúng. Dưới đây là một trường hợp ứng dụng mà chúng tôi sử dụng AutoHotkey.
Mục lục
- 1 Cài đặt AutoHotkey
- 2 Các script AutoHotkey hay nhất
- 2.1 1. Biến phím Caps-Lock của bạn thành nút Mute
- 2.2 2. Auto-Complete lúc đánh văn bản
- 2.3 3. Khôi phục chức năng thư mục của phím Backspace
- 2.4 4. Xóa định dạng văn bản lúc dán
- 2.5 5. Xóa những email trong Outlook bằng một kích chuột
- 2.6 6. AutoCorrect lúc đánh văn bản
- 2.7 7. Vô hiệu hóa phím Lock
- 2.8 8. Thiết lập lại chức năng cho Caps Lock
- 2.9 9. Xem nhanh hoặc ẩn tệp ẩn
- 2.10 10. Nhanh chóng hiển thị hoặc ẩn đuôi tập tin
- 2.11 11. Chèn những ký tự tính năng hot
- 2.12 12. Bắt chước phím tìm kiếm của Chromebook
- 2.13 13. Sử dụng bàn phím số như con chuột
- 2.14 14. Khởi chạy bất kỳ ứng dụng nào
- 2.15 15. Dán vào Command Prompt
Cài đặt AutoHotkey
Trước lúc mang thể thử một số script hoặc viết script của riêng bạn, bạn cần phải cài đặt AutoHotkey.
Sau lúc cài đặt xong, chương trình sẽ thực hiện những script bạn viết bằng tiếng nói của một dân tộc AutoHotkey, nhưng chưa mang bất kỳ script nào để chạy. Để tạo một script mới, hãy đảm bảo AutoHotkey triển khai (bằng nhữngh mở menu Start và gõ AutoHotkey để chạy chương trình), sau đó kích chuột phải vào bất cứ đâu trên desktop hoặc bất cứ nơi nào khác thuận tiện và mua New > AutoHotkey Script. Đặt tên cho nó và đảm bảo tệp kết thúc bằng .ahk nếu ko nó sẽ ko hoạt động chính xác.
Nếu đang viết một script cho AutoHotkey, bạn nên nâng cấp trình soạn thảo văn bản của mình. Notepad ++ là một lựa mua miễn phí tuyệt vời và được khuyến khích cho mục đích này. Lưu ý rằng bạn mang thể mở trình soạn thảo văn bản của bạn, gõ một số code và chỉ cần lưu nó với đuôi bằng .ahk và bạn sẽ đạt được kết quả tương tự như phương pháp trên.
Bây giờ bạn đã mang ứng dụng chạy script, giờ chỉ cần tải những code mà những người khác đã viết để tự động hóa tất cả những loại làm việc. Để lưu một script, chỉ cần tải nó xuống dưới dạng tệp .ahk và lưu nó bất cứ nơi nào bạn muốn.
Nếu bạn muốn một trong số những script này chạy ngay lúc bạn khởi động máy tính thì mang thể sao chép và dán những tệp tin .ahk vào thư mục Startup bằng nhữngh gõ shell:startup vào menu Start hoặc duyệt tới vị trí sau:
C:Users[USERNAME]AppDataRoamingMicrosoftWindowsStart MenuProgramsStartup.
Các script AutoHotkey hay nhất
Dưới đây là một số script tốt nhất mà bạn mang thể sử dụng để làm cho Windows tốt hơn.
1. Biến phím Caps-Lock của bạn thành nút Mute
Bạn đã bao giờ mang ý muốn mình mang thể làm câm những loa máy tính trong một chốc lát, tương đương lúc điện thoại đổ chuông, bạn cần làm phải mang ko gian tĩnh lặng để thực hiện được cuộc đàm thoại của mình. Một số bàn phím máy tính mang nút Mute để thực hiện mục đích đó, tuy nhiên ko phải tất cả bàn phím nào cũng mang.
Nếu bàn phím của bạn ko tư vấn nút Mute như đã nói ở trên, ko nên quá lo lắng hay nghĩ nhữngh mua một bàn phím mới, chúng tôi sẽ chỉ cho những bạn nhữngh biến phím Caps-Lock thông thường trên bàn phím của mình thành nút Mute bằng AutoHotkey.
Chạy AutoHotkey và thực hiện theo trình tự duới đây:
1. Chạy Notepad.
2. Copy và paste dòng dưới đây vào tài liệu Notepad: CapsLock::Send {Volume_Mute}
3. Lưu file với tên Mute.ahk.
4. Kích đúp vào file để chạy nó.
Lúc này, lúc bạn nhấn phím Caps-Lock, hệ thống loa của bạn sẽ bị làm câm. Nhấn thêm lần nữa nó sẽ được trở về trạng thái mở ban đầu.
Nếu bạn muốn vô hiệu hóa tạm thời tính năng này, kích phải vào biểu tượng AutoHotKey trong System Tray và mua Suspend Hotkeys.
2. Auto-Complete lúc đánh văn bản
Auto-Complete là một tính năng khá hữu dụng trong đánh văn bản, bất cứ lúc nào bạn đánh một chữ viết tắt đã được định nghĩa từ trước, ví dụ, đánh qtm, lúc đó AHK sẽ thay thế nó bằng cụm từ “quan tri mang“. Đây là một nhữngh làm tiết kiệm được khá nhiều thời gian với những cụm từ lặp đi lặp lại nhiều lần trong bất cứ trình soạn thảo nào.
Dưới đây là nhữngh thiết lập Auto-Complete trong AHK
- Chạy AutoHotkey.
- Trong vùng mở nào đó trên desktop, kích phải vào đó và mua New, AutoHotkey script.
- Nhập vào tên của kịch bản (trong trường hợp này là qtm.ahk) và nhấn Enter.
- Kích phải vào file này và mua Edit Script.
- Tìm một dòng trống và đánh vào đó ::qtm:: quan tri mang
- Chọn File, Exit, cần lưu những thay đổi của bạn.
- Kích phải vào file và mua Run Script.
Lúc này, bất cứ lúc nào bạn đánh qtm và nhấn dấu nhữngh hoặc dấu chấm câu, AHK sẽ thay thế nó bằng cụm từ “quan tri mang“.
3. Khôi phục chức năng thư mục của phím Backspace
Nếu bạn là người thích sử dụng những phím tắt trên bàn phím thì cứng cáp chắn bạn sẽ thđó một điều rằng trong Windows Vista và Windows 7, phím Backspace ko làm việc tương đương trong Windows XP. Nó vẫn mang thể xóa lùi những ký tự ngược về phía trái của con trỏ – tuy nhiên lúc bạn xem những thư mục trong Windows Explorer, Backspace sẽ ko đưa bạn ngược lên một thư mục trong kiến trúc cây của nó như trong XP.
Tuy nhiên với AHK, bạn mang thể sử dụng đoạn mã sau để làm cho chức năng của phím Backspace như những gì nó vẫn mang trong XP – trong phối cảnh điều hướng thư mục. Chúng tôi sẽ chỉ cung cấp cho bạn đoạn mã, còn lại những bước thực hiện sẽ tương tự như phần những phần ở trên.
#IfWinActive, ahk_class CabinetWClass
Backspace::
ControlGet renamestatus,Visible,,Edit1,A
ControlGetFocus focussed, A
if(renamestatus!=1&&(focussed=”DirectUIHWND3″||focussed=SysTreeView321))
{
SendInput {Alt Down}{Up}{Alt Up}
}else{
Send {Backspace}
}
#IfWinActive
4. Xóa định dạng văn bản lúc dán
Khi bạn thực hiện copy và paste một văn bản từ một trang web nào đó vào công cụ blog của mình, hoặc từ Word vào Web thường xuất hiện kiểu định dạng ko mong muốn.
Lúc này AutoHotkey mang thể giải quyết vấn đề cho bạn với đoạn mã sau:
$^v::
ClipSaved := ClipboardAll ;save original clipboard contents
clipboard = %clipboard% ;remove formatting
Send ^v ;send the Ctrl+V command
Clipboard := ClipSaved ;restore the original clipboard contents
ClipSaved = ;clear the variable
Return
$^+v::
Send ^v ;just send the regular paste command
Return
5. Xóa những email trong Outlook bằng một kích chuột
Bạn mang thể thay đổi chức năng của nút chuột giữa của mình cho những chương trình nào đó. Sử dụng đoạn mã dưới đây trong AHK sẽ cho phép bạn xóa những email trong Outlook inbox bằng nhữngh kích nút chuột giữa vào chúng.
; Lets delete Outlook emails with a wheel button
; By Grigory Shevchenko
#SingleInstance,Force
#NoEnv
#IfWinActive ahk_class rctrl_renwnd32
~MButton::
MouseClick, Left
sleep 10
Send, ^d
return
6. AutoCorrect lúc đánh văn bản
Đây là một script cũ, nhưng lỗi chính tả ko “lỗi thời”. Nó chứa hàng ngàn lỗi chính tả thông thường và lúc bạn thực hiện một lỗi, nó sẽ ngay lập tức thay thế nó bằng từ đúng. Nó thậm chí còn cho phép bạn chỉnh sửa những từ của chính mình.
Download: Script cho AutoCorrect.
7. Vô hiệu hóa phím Lock
Ba phím Lock – Num Lock, Caps Lock và Scroll Lock – ko thực sự được sử dụng thường xuyên. Bạn mang thể chỉ sử dụng bàn phím số, ko bao giờ nhấn Caps Lock ngoại trừ vô tình bấm vào nó và thậm chí ko biết Scroll Lock được tiêu dùng để làm gì. Ngoài trừ Windows sẽ phát một âm thanh lúc nhấn phím này, tuy nhiên hãy thử đặt chúng với một giá trị mặc định khác với script này.
; Set Lock keys permanently
SetNumlockState, AlwaysOn
SetCapsLockState, AlwaysOff
SetScrollLockState, AlwaysOff
return
Script này sẽ làm cho những phím Num Lock luôn bật và vô hiệu hóa những phím CapsLock và Scroll Lock. Nếu bạn muốn tắt cả phím NumLock thì mang thể đổi On thành Off hoặc xóa bỏ dòng đó đi.
8. Thiết lập lại chức năng cho Caps Lock
Một lúc bạn đã sử dụng code trên để vô hiệu hóa Caps Lock, bạn mang thể thiết lập cho nó với một chức năng khác.
Sử dụng script này sẽ biến Caps Lock thành phím Shift khác, bạn thậm chí mang thể thay đổi nó thành bất cứ thứ gì bạn muốn (mang thể là một phím Windows khác):
; Turn Caps Lock into a Shift key
Capslock::Shift
return
9. Xem nhanh hoặc ẩn tệp ẩn
Nếu bạn muốn truy cập vào những thư mục ẩn trong windows thì đây là script cho bạn. Script này chỉ đơn thuần là bạn nhấn phím Windows + H với bất kỳ thư mục nào để xem những tệp hoặc thư mục ẩn.
Download: Script xem những file ẩn.
10. Nhanh chóng hiển thị hoặc ẩn đuôi tập tin
Tương tự trên, đôi lúc bạn muốn xem đuôi tập tin của mỗi tập tin. Điều này rất hữu ích nếu bạn mang nhiều tệp cùng tên hoặc muốn đảm bảo rằng nội dung bạn đã tải xuống là một tệp PDF chứ ko phải là tệp .exe nguy hiểm. Script bên dưới sẽ cho phép bạn bật/tắt đuôi tập tin cho những tệp tin với phím Windows + Y.
Download: Script hiển thị đuôi tệp tin.
11. Chèn những ký tự tính năng hot
Mặc dù bàn phím của bạn mang một số ký tự tính năng hot (như @ hoặc *), nhưng mang hàng tá ký tự khác mà bạn cần tiêu dùng và ko muốn lúc cần lại phải tìm trong Symbol của Word hoặc săn lùng những code Alt. Vậy thì hãy để dòng code AHK này giúp bạn.
Sử dụng mẫu dưới đây để tạo phím tắt sẽ hữu ích cho bạn. Các ký tự bên trái là những ký tự bạn cần bấm để kích hoạt những phím tắt, trong lúc những biểu tượng bên trong những dấu ngoặc kép là những gì được chèn vào. Vì vậy, nếu bạn muốn nhấn ALT + Q để chèn biểu tượng nhãn hiệu, bạn sẽ gõ:
!q::SendInput {™}
Để tham khảo, những ký tự cho những phím, bạn mang thể đọc thêm về những phím hotkey trên trang hướng dẫn của AHK.
12. Bắt chước phím tìm kiếm của Chromebook
Chromebook của Google mang nhiều phím tắt riêng, Google đã quyết định loại bỏ phím Caps Lock ko được sử dụng thường xuyên và thay thế bằng nút tìm kiếm trên máy của họ. Bạn cũng mang thể mang được chức năng tương tự như vậy với một script đơn thuần.
Thao tác này sẽ khởi chạy trình duyệt mặc định của bạn và tìm kiếm Google bất kỳ văn bản nào bạn đã đánh dấu lúc nhấn Ctrl + Shift + C. Rất tiện để giảm thời gian sao chép và dán.
^+c::
{
Send, ^c
Sleep 50
Run, http://www.google.com/search?q=%clipboard%
Return
}
13. Sử dụng bàn phím số như con chuột
Script này sẽ sử dụng bàn phím số hoạt động như một con chuột, cho phép bạn di chuyển chính xác hơn và trong trường hợp con chuột của bạn bị hỏng.
Download: Script sử dụng bàn phím số như con chuột.
14. Khởi chạy bất kỳ ứng dụng nào
Trình khởi chạy như Launchy rất tuyệt vời để kéo bất kỳ chương trình nào được cài đặt trên máy tính chỉ trong vài giây, nhưng đối với những chương trình được sử dụng nhiều, bạn mang thể cần một nhữngh nhanh hơn. Script sau mở một ứng dụng rất đơn thuần, bạn chỉ cần nhần phím Windows + F để mở Firefox.
#f::Run Firefox
15. Dán vào Command Prompt
Cho tới Windows 10, bạn phải nhấp chuột phải và mua Paste để dán bất cứ thứ gì vào một dòng lệnh, phím tắt thông thường Ctrl + V ko hoạt động. Nhưng giờ đây với script này, bạn mang thể sử dụng Ctrl + V để dán vào Command Prompt như bình thường.
#IfWinActive ahk_class ConsoleWindowClass
^V::
SendInput {Raw}%clipboard%
return
#IfWinActive
Điều tuyệt vời về AutoHotkey là nó hoàn toàn tùy biến theo nhu cầu của bạn. Bạn mang thể thiết lập thành bất cứ phím tắt nào bạn muốn với những chức năng khác nhau.
Các bạn đang xem tin tức tại Tin hay 24h – Chúc những bạn một ngày vui vẻ
Từ khóa: Làm việc hiệu quả hơn với công cụ miễn phí AutoHotkey